WebAug 9, 2024 · Why do deeds have $10 consideration? To be legally binding as a contract, a promise must be exchanged for adequate consideration. Adequate consideration is a … WebDec 3, 2024 · Sometimes, the number is $10, and sometimes, the sequence of the words is slightly different. However, such a statement (we can call that statement the “one-dollar phrase”) appears in almost every real estate deed, whether the real estate was a gift or whether it was sold for $1 million.

WebSep 17, 2024 · In Arkansas, many deeds say something along the lines of "FOR AND IN VALUABLE CONSIDERATION OF TEN DOLLARS ($10.00), and other good and valuable consideration..." This is tradition, and perfectly legal.
